NFT Game SolChicks is Ready for Launch, Here’s How it Works

Estimated read time 3 min read
  • Catheon Gaming is pleased to announce the launch of the initial beta version of the SolChicks game.
  • The much anticipated NFT game is to be launched with a small crowd of gamers given the privilege of a sneak peeks.

The beta version of the game comes off the back of the successful launch of the SolChicks minigame earlier this year. The initial beta will be launched as a closed beta test to be accessible by the Solchicks NFT holders.

Catheon gaming is the fastest-growing blockchain emerging giant. It is considered the leading Web3 gaming ecosystem with a portfolio of more than 25 games of the highest quality.

The closed beta test will be open from 15 October at 12 pm UTC for 3 days until 18 October, 12 pm UTC, and will be available on both mobile (Android) and PC. Detailed instructions on how to register are available at http://www.solchicks.io/closed-beta.

Catheon Gaming has also recently announced that the SolChicks $CHICKS token will be officially rebranding and relaunching as Catheon Gaming’s universal governance and utility token, $CATHEON, which will be used across the entire Catheon Gaming ecosystem, including the SolChicks game.

This will be the first token of its kind on Solana and Polygon networks and with the entire Catheon Gaming brand and portfolio behind it, $CATHEON will be the most developed ecosystem token of its kind in terms of utility and the breadth of the ecosystem backing it.

Gamers will play the first three chapters in the story mode as Talonyr. This is the game’s main protagonist as he makes an epic journey across the planet mellow.

Teams of five SolChicks are to enter into battle and the players will need to think strategically when assembling the squad, which should have a perfect blend of active and passive skills. If certain skills are executed in the right sequence, they will cause greater damage in battle.

Overpowering monsters will pump up each SolChicks experience level and deliver the much-needed enhancements to their weapons and equipment. Given how each level gets progressively harder, this means it be nothing short of crucial.

SolChicks’ developers say there’s going to be plenty to look forward to, even in this initial beta stage. More than 50 stages are going to be on offer, each with its own type of monster.
